Transaction 589453eaeea4499a1896ad6b562ba9c96f0e086049036048413453965edae22a
1 Input
1 Output
-
589453eaeea4499a1896ad6b562ba9c96f0e086049036048413453965edae22a:0
- value
- 299811085
- script pubkey
- OP_0 OP_PUSHBYTES_20 b4c41039948e88c6ecbf128d6cc7de0145fc1b9e
- address
- bc1qknzpqwv536yvdm9lz2xke377q9zlcxu7ycc6ue